Bleda
Bleda (390-445) fue rey de los hunos de manera conjunta con su hermano Atila después de la muerte del rey Rugila. Ambos eran hijos del noble huno Mundzuk. En un primer momento Bleda y Atila optaron por proseguir la paz con el Imperio romano de Oriente a cambio de que el emperador Teodosio II duplicara los tributos anuales (ascendiendo estos a 700 libras anuales) y entregara a varios desertores que habían huido al sur del Danubio y se habían refugiado con los romanos. Durante los cinco años siguientes se mantuvo la paz, tiempo que Bleda y Atila aprovecharon para realizar incursiones al sur del Cáucaso, aunque fueron derrotados cuando trataban de saquear Armenia. En 439 acusaron a los romanos de romper el acuerdo después de que el obispo de la ciudad de Margus cruzara el Danubio y profanara las tumbas reales hunas que había en su orilla norte.
